Mainama

Mainama is a village located in Manu subdivision of Dhalai district in Tripura,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Manu (tehsildar office) and 33km away from district headquarter Ambassa.

About Mainama

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mainama is 272480. The village spans a total geographical area of 1081 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 799275. Kailasahar is nearest town to Mainama village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 48km away.

Population of Mainama

According to the 2011 Census, Mainama has a total population of about 5,586, with approximately 2,880 males and 2,706 females. The sex ratio is around 939 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 672 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 46 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 3,760. The overall literacy rate is approximately 76.23%, with male literacy at about 81.32% and female literacy near 70.81%. There are around 1,232 households in the village. Connectivity of Mainama

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mainama. As per the 2011 stats, Mainama had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
